When evaluating a medic bed, focus on features that align with your facility’s specific needs. The right medic bed balances functionality, safety, and durability while accommodating the unique requirements of patients and staff. Below are critical features to consider when making your selection.

Adjustability and Customization Options

A high-quality medic bed offers extensive adjustability to cater to various medical conditions. Look for beds with motorized adjustments for height, head, and foot sections, as these allow precise positioning for patient comfort and clinical procedures. Some advanced hospital beds include Trendelenburg and reverse Trendelenburg positions, which are crucial for specific treatments in ICU settings. Expert’s medic beds are equipped with cutting-edge adjustment mechanisms to meet diverse clinical demands.

Safety Features of Medic Beds

Safety is non-negotiable in medical environments. A hospital bed should include lockable side rails, emergency stop buttons, and low-height settings to prevent falls. Beds with integrated alarms for patient movement or weight shifts enhance safety in high-risk settings. Durability and Material Quality

Medic beds are a long-term investment, so durability is key. Look for beds constructed from high-quality materials like stainless steel or reinforced polymers that withstand frequent use and cleaning. A durable hospital bed resists wear and tear, ensuring reliability in demanding environments. Arten von Medic Beds for Different Needs

Not all medic beds are created equal, and different healthcare settings require specific types of beds. Understanding the various types of hospital beds available can help you choose one that aligns with your facility’s requirements.

Standard Hospital Hospital Beds

Standard hospital hospital beds are versatile and suitable for general wards. They typically offer basic adjustability, such as height and backrest adjustments, and are ideal for patients requiring short-term care. These beds prioritize simplicity and reliability, making them a cost-effective choice for many facilities.

ICU Medic Beds

ICU medic beds are designed for critical care environments, offering advanced features like full-body positioning, integrated monitoring systems, and compatibility with medical equipment. These beds support complex patient needs, such as those in post-surgical recovery or intensive care. Long-Term Care Hospital Beds

For nursing homes or rehabilitation centers, long-term care hospital beds focus on patient comfort over extended periods. These beds often include pressure-relieving mattresses and enhanced adjustability to prevent bedsores and improve circulation. They are designed to support patients with chronic conditions or limited mobility.

Space and Compatibility

The physical dimensions of a medic bed are crucial, especially in compact hospital rooms or ICUs. Measure your space to ensure the bed fits comfortably while allowing room for medical equipment and caregiver movement. Additionally, ensure the bed is compatible with existing mattresses, monitors, or other equipment. FAQ

What is a medic bed?

A medic bed is a specialized hospital bed designed for medical environments, offering adjustable features, safety mechanisms, and durability to support patient care and caregiver efficiency.

Wie wähle ich das richtige medic bed for my facility?

Consider factors like adjustability, safety features, durability, budget, and space constraints. Evaluate your facility’s specific needs, such as whether it’s for general wards, ICU, or long-term care.

What are the key safety features of a medic bed?

Key safety features include lockable side rails, low-height settings, emergency stop buttons, and integrated alarms for patient movement or equipment malfunctions.
